CaTiN3 is a calcium titanium nitride compound belonging to the family of transition metal nitrides, which are ceramic materials known for high hardness and thermal stability. This material is primarily of research and development interest rather than established industrial production; it represents exploration within the nitride family for potential applications requiring high-temperature strength, wear resistance, and chemical stability. The nitride compound class has shown promise in cutting tools, protective coatings, and refractory applications where conventional alloys fall short.
